Gene Clark left just as the Byrds were to start recording their 3rd album. He disliked pop stardom and especially flying...so, the rest of the band moved on and developed into a raga folk psych band, departing from their straight folkrock sound of 1965.

'Eight Miles High' is an early and glorious psychedelic masterpiece. And, it is a masterpiece, from start to finish. So much so, it still sounds absolutely thrilling and contemporary even today. That bass riff, that 'raga' see-sawing amazing guitar, the lyrics... David Crosby and Roger McGuinn 'finished' the song after Gene Clark left, adding to the song so it eventually became a rare but true collaborative writing effort. The rest of the album flows in the hip groove sounds of the sixties, including 'I See You' which fits into the same sort of mold as 'Eight Miles High'. David Crosby's 'What's Happening?!?!' sports perfect lead vocals with great guitar parts from McGuinn to 'answer' the questions posed by David lyrically - a lovely song. The singles 5D and 'Mr Spaceman' are both entertaining and quirky, although hardly in the same league as 'Eight Miles High'. Still, to finish the album we have a lovely version of 'John Riley' which features good Byrds harmony work. The whole record, almost without exception, actually 'sounds' great. It's a fine album and Gene Clark's loss had been overcome -- an achievement considering how much he'd dominated their early original material.
